Pharmacy Technician IV - Inpatient Pharmacy
On-siteLittle Rock, Arkansas, United States
Job Summary
Direct technician staff in assigned areas, lead pharmacy technicians and volunteers on daily dispensing, compounding sterile preparations, and workflow tasks. Manage inventory by handling stockouts, replenishing Pyxis systems, and ensuring proper refrigeration of returned items. Provide formal, in-depth training and onboarding for new hires and rotation students, serving as the onboarding and training coordinator. Operate under limited supervision in the cleanroom to maintain USP 797, 795, and 800 compliance while triaging phone calls and promoting excellent customer service. Collaborate with department leadership to develop pharmacy improvement initiatives and address operational monitoring and regulatory compliance issues.
Required Qualifications
- HS/GED plus 4 yrs Pharmacy Tech Experience or a Bachelor's Degree in Pharmaceutical Sciences
- 1 year to obtain ASHP/ACPE accredited technician training or certificate program
- National Technician Certification (PTCB)
- Arkansas Pharmacy Technician Registration
- Persons must have proof of legal authority to work in the United States on the first day of employment
- Annual TB Screening
- Criminal Background Check
- Substance Abuse Testing
